def dynamic_rnn_lstm(data, input_dim, class_dim, emb_dim, lstm_size):
|
||||
emb = fluid.layers.embedding(
|
||||
input=data, size=[input_dim, emb_dim], is_sparse=True)
|
||||
sentence = fluid.layers.fc(input=emb, size=lstm_size, act='tanh')
|
||||
|
||||
rnn = fluid.layers.DynamicRNN()
|
||||
with rnn.block():
|
||||
word = rnn.step_input(sentence)
|
||||
prev_hidden = rnn.memory(value=0.0, shape=[lstm_size])
|
||||
prev_cell = rnn.memory(value=0.0, shape=[lstm_size])
|
||||
|
||||
def gate_common(ipt, hidden, size):
|
||||
gate0 = fluid.layers.fc(input=ipt, size=size, bias_attr=True)
|
||||
gate1 = fluid.layers.fc(input=hidden, size=size, bias_attr=False)
|
||||
return gate0 + gate1
|
||||
|
||||
forget_gate = fluid.layers.sigmoid(x=gate_common(word, prev_hidden,
|
||||
lstm_size))
|
||||
input_gate = fluid.layers.sigmoid(x=gate_common(word, prev_hidden,
|
||||
lstm_size))
|
||||
output_gate = fluid.layers.sigmoid(x=gate_common(word, prev_hidden,
|
||||
lstm_size))
|
||||
cell_gate = fluid.layers.sigmoid(x=gate_common(word, prev_hidden,
|
||||
lstm_size))
|
||||
|
||||
cell = forget_gate * prev_cell + input_gate * cell_gate
|
||||
hidden = output_gate * fluid.layers.tanh(x=cell)
|
||||
rnn.update_memory(prev_cell, cell)
|
||||
rnn.update_memory(prev_hidden, hidden)
|
||||
rnn.output(hidden)
|
||||
|
||||
last = fluid.layers.sequence_last_step(rnn())
|
||||
prediction = fluid.layers.fc(input=last, size=class_dim, act="softmax")
|
||||
return prediction
